Endless Sights, Scents and Flavors 
Throughout the city, taste buds are treated to the delicacies of everything from Michelin-star restaurants to roadside vendors offering local favorites such as dim sum. The city’s 1,200 skyscrapers may seem daunting from the streets, but from Victoria Peak, known as the “Back of the Dragon,” the buildings’ lights dazzle in the distance against the night sky.

Shopping in Hong Kong brings senses to life with options that range from luxury malls to street markets, including the popular Jade Market and Flower Market which sell exactly what their names suggest. In a city full of contrast, hiking provides a natural escape from urban exploration, with trails right outside the city leading to remote temples and secluded beaches. Hong Kong’s culture truly comes alive during the city’s festivals including Chinese New Year, Arts Month and the Dragon Boat Festival.

The Cruise Gateway to Asia 
More than 15 cruise lines feature Hong Kong as a port of call, making it a very diverse cruise port. Many of these voyages embark or disembark in Hong Kong, which in large part serves as a gateway to all of Asia’s splendors.

To the north, cruises sail to Japan and South Korea, including Royal Caribbean International’s newly debuted Ovation of the Seas. To the south, both large ocean liners and boutique-style ships sail to Thailand, Vietnam, the Philippines and Singapore. For the ultimate China itinerary, Yangtze River cruise itineraries depart from Hong Kong and combine a river cruise sailing with stops in Beijing to walk along the Great Wall of China and Xi’an to marvel at the Terracotta Army.
